If a person has a slow metabolism they may gain weight more easily. Inactivity and illness can cause a slow metabolism. Your doctor can give more information on this.

Adding lemon to water, or drinking it neat, will not speed up your metabolism. However, hard effort through cardio exercise and weight training, with dietary changes (the three things combined), can help to speed up your metabolism.
